VENTURE CAPITAL

With over 40 years of experience and over $845 million invested across various funds, First Analysis is a leading venture capital investor in B2B tech companies. Primarily investing in North America, we target entrepreneur-driven, capital-efficient companies with proven business models and demonstrable customer successes. We partner with our portfolio companies to build for successful exits in every investment we undertake. We invest $3 to $10 million, either as a lead investor or as a syndicate partner bringing valuable insights and expertise in our focus sectors.

We don’t just invest – we partner. As the largest investor in our own funds, we engage deeply with each portfolio company. Our strategy? Selective investments in sectors in which our research provides differentiated insight, with a focus on building toward a successful exit. This means more hands-on board involvement, fostering stakeholder alignment and achieving high-quality results with favorable valuations.
Our investment vision is clear: empowering entrepreneur-driven, capital-efficient growth companies. We target businesses with $1 to $10 million in annual recurring revenue within our focus sectors, investing from $3 to $10 million. Each year, we commit to only a small number of platforms, dedicating our resources for truly impactful engagement.

First Analysis invests in Gradient Cyber, provider of MXDR services for mid-market organizations
First Analysis, a leading venture capital investor, has made a new investment in Gradient Cyber, a leading provider of managed extended detection and response (MXDR) services for mid-market organizations. First Analysis led the Series A financing, which will support Gradient Cyber's continued growth and product development as it scales to meet increasing demand for 24/7 MXDR services.

First Analysis closes on Fund XIV at $97 million in committed capital
First Analysis, a leading venture capital firm specializing in B2B technology investments, announced today the closing of its 14th fund at $97 million in committed capital. First Analysis again committed substantial capital to its own fund, making it the largest investor in the new fund and underscoring its continued confidence in its distinctive investment approach.

First Analysis portfolio company PCMI receives strategic growth investment from Thoma Bravo
Thoma Bravo, a leading software investment firm, has made a strategic growth investment in PCMI, a portfolio company of First Analysis and Equality Asset Management. PCMI is a leading provider of administration software for finance and insurance products in the automotive and consumer end markets. Thoma Bravo's expertise in scaling technology companies will help accelerate PCMI's global growth and support its efforts in enhancing the platform.
